Where is the Gayou family from?

You can see how Gayou families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Gayou family name was found in the USA in 1880. In 1880 there were 12 Gayou families living in Wisconsin. This was about 67% of all the recorded Gayou's in USA. Wisconsin had the highest population of Gayou families in 1880.

What is the average Gayou lifespan?

Between 1944 and 2001, in the United States, Gayou life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1983, and highest in 1985. The average life expectancy for Gayou in 1944 was 54, and 71 in 2001.
